South African artists will come together in July to remember musician Bongani Masuku at a benefit concert on 2 July 2014 at The Joburg Theatre.
The music fraternity learnt the shocking news of Masuku's untimely death on the evening of 17 May 2014. He was tragically shot and killed in Troyville. Masuku was a long standing band member of Johnny Clegg and he left behind his wife, Linah Masuku, and their four children.


The line-up for the benefit concert will include top musicians:
Ard Matthews
Claire Johnston from Mango Groove
Jesse Clegg
Johnny Clegg and his band
Khanyo
Ringo
Ross Learmonth from Prime Circle
Sibongile Khumalo
Sipho Hotstix Mabuse
Victor Masondo
Yvonne Chaka Chaka
